To begin , I put Harrison die on the craft card stock and drew its outline with a friction pen. I covered with some different kinds of Tim Holtz Vintage design tapelonger than the out line 、and die-cut the pieces (face, mane, and body ) that are used to theHarrison .
I colored directly to the paper with Distress Antique linen on the surface wrinkles. For the background, I cut the Distress white Heavy stock5.5”×5.5”, and made 1.5-inch crease, and sprayed with Distress Salvaged patina and Spiced marmalade. I attached a acetate sheet 4”× 5.5” to the 1.5 inch part with double side tape, and covered there with some different kinds of Tim Holtz Vintage design tape .
I made a crease in V at an angle of 110 degrees to two pop-up pieces(V-Fold). The left side of them is short ! Because the cover is transparent so I made them invisible . If you stick it parallel to the center of the card , the pieces will move together when you shut the card.
I cut the part that sticks out when shut the card, and put it on top of so that Harrison would be visible. I cut the pop up base into a rock shape.
